> More info on this - > > Howard @ Elecraft Support promptly sent me the factory default config file > for the radio that fixed the issue. But later, I was able to reproduce the > issue and also fix without the factory configuration. > > I have the KX3 hooked up to Ham Radio Deluxe (latest version) with serial > interface for CAT control. HRD works with the radio for the most part except > I noticed this in the Radio CAT commands configuration - > > | Advanced: KX3 | RF power (High) | Cmd = PC-04, Min = 0.00, Max = > 120.00, Prefix =, Suffix = | > | Advanced: KX3 | RF power (Low) | Cmd = PC-04, Min = 0.00, Max = > 120.00, Prefix =, Suffix = | > > Notice the “Max = 120” part? Those values show up on HRD UI as - > > RF Power Low = 12 > RF Power High = 120 > > There are two RF power adjustment bard in HRD UI. The “RF Power Low” slider > works OK (has other issues) with the KX3 12 watt limit. But even touching the > “RF Power High” slider causes the KX3 to switch RF power value to 110+ Watts > (Yes, without a KXPA100, I wish). > > Once that happens, the ATU disengages and the radio refuses to transmit. > > The easy way to fix this is to touch the “RF Power Low” slider and the radio > switches back to under 12W and everything goes back to normal. Shouldn’t the > KX3 itself handle this gracefully without tripping over the ATU with bunch of > errors? > > I am a brand new HRD user and still getting used to the UI.
